        Aim: Gender identity disorders (GID) are heterogeneous disorders that may be influenced by culture and social norms The purpose of the present research was to study the effectiveness of acceptance and commitment based therapy on social adjustment, mental turmoil and self-rupturing among people with transgender sexual disorder, Materials and Method: this research was a semi-experimental. The sample of the research included 30 individuals with Transgender sexual disorder in well-being organization of north Khorasan, they were selected by available sampling and were placed randomly in experimental and control group randomly. Data were obtained by mental health questionnaire SCL-25, self-rupturing questionnaire of Sadegh-zade et al. (2006), and Bell social adjustment inventory (1961). Findings were analyzed by SPSS software and multi-variate covariance analysis test. Results: The results show that acceptance and commitment based therapy significantly promoted social adjustment and mental turmoil and also reduced self-rupturing among people with transgender sexual disorder (P<0.01). discussion: according to the findings of the research it can be said that utilizing new treatments in psychotherapy and counseling such as acceptance and commitment based therapy may be effective on improving mental state of people with transgender sexual disorder, so due to their special problems in Iran it is necessary to utilize such treatments for them.         The issue of sexual dysfunction is one of the emerging phenomena that has been less studied in jurisprudential research and studies. One of the issues related to sexual dysfunction is what effect this phenomenon has on the issue of "couple benevolence". To answer this question, jurisprudential and legal texts must be examined and analyzed. The research finding is that according to the criteria and areas of leaving Ehsan, sexual disorders can also be considered as obstacles to the realization of Ehsan. Legally, according to Article 227 of the Islamic Penal Code adopted in 1392 and the phrase "such matters" in this article indicates that the above cases are not exclusive examples of obstacles to the realization of sexuality and therefore sexual disorders can be among the obstacles to realization.
